bluckan (=Ir. bolgán) ball, ball bearing, croquette: Nee eh son shickyrys dy dewil oo y hyndaa as y hilgey myr bluckan gys cheer lhean Bible
bluckan coshey football: Ta ny politickeyryn ayns Kiare as Feed Hostyn ayns Lunnin gymmydey Bretnish myr bluckan-coshey politickagh Carn
ball (n.) bluggan; bluckan: They were kicking the ball about - V'ad brebbal y bluckan mygeayrt. DF idiom; crig; daunse; (v.) bluckaney, jannoo bluckan jeh
football (n.) bluckan coshey: Watching a football match - Jeeaghyn er cloie bluckan coshey. DF idiom; bluckaneyrys
snowball (n.) bluckan sniaghtee; (v.) ceau bluckan sniaghtee; gaase dy tappee: This thing will snowball - Nee'n red shoh gaase dy tappee. DF idiom

This is a mirror of Phil Kelly's Manx vocabulary (Fockleyreen). It contains over 130,000 entries. This mirror was created 2 December 2014.
